Blackjack

Also referred to as 21, blackjack is one of the most popular games at casinos because of their simple rules and low house edge. Besides, blackjack greatly appeals to players who prefer games of skill and strategy over games of chance. Blackjack is a strategy game that challenges players to use their wits to lower the house edge further.

Although there are several variants of blackjack to choose from, they are all governed by the rules of traditional blackjack. In case of blackjack, players play against the dealer. The objective of the game is to beat the dealer by either getting blackjack or a hand stronger than the dealer’s. While playing blackjack, the aces are always 1 or 11 depending on the situation, the picture cards are always 10, and the number cards are taken at face value. The strongest hand in blackjack is a hand equaling 21.

Characteristics of blackjack games

There are over 100 documented variants of blackjack, and though based on standard blackjack rules, each variant is differs with regard to number of decks used, availability of insurance and surrender options, house edge, and so on.

In most international casinos, dealers are not allowed to check their second card until players have finished making their moves. Depending on the gambling laws of the land, casinos may offer different payouts for blackjack. For instance, some casinos pay 6-5 or 1-1 instead of the customary 3-2. Rules governing payouts for ties also vary among various casinos.

Here is a comparison of rules governing some of the most popular blackjack variants:

Variant House Edge Decks Dealer Rules Doubling Rules Special Features
European Blackjack 0.39% 2 Stands on soft 17 Double on 9 – 11, doubling after splitting not allowed Variant has no surrender and no hole card.
Atlantic City Blackjack 0.35% 8 Stands on soft 17 Doubling after splitting allowed, double on first two cards Dealer can check for blackjack. Variant has no surrender option.
Multi-hand Blackjack 0.63% 5 Stands on soft 17 Doubling after splitting not allowed, Doubling only on 9 – 11 Variant has five betting positions, but no surrender and no hole card.
Vegas Strip Blackjack 0.34% 4 Stands on soft 17 Double on first two cards, doubling after splitting allowed Dealer can check for blackjack.
Vegas Downtown Blackjack 0.38% 2 Hits on soft 17 Double on first two cards, doubling after splitting allowed Re-splitting is allowed up to 3 hands. Dealer can check for blackjack.
Double Exposure Blackjack 0.69% 8 Hits on soft 17 Doubling only on hard 9 – 11, doubling after splitting allowed In case of tie, dealer wins. However, if both get blackjack, player will win.
Single Deck Blackjack 0.058% 1 Hits on soft 17 Doubling on first two card, doubling after splitting allowed Dealer can check for blackjack.
Blackjack Switch 0.17% 6 or 8 Hits on soft 17 Doubling on any 2 cards, doubling after splitting allowed If upcard is 10 or ace, dealer can check for blackjack. Players play two hands and can switch cards from one hand to the other.

Online gaming content providers are aware that traditional blackjack tends to get boring, owing to which they have attached progressive jackpots to several blackjack variants. Players only have to place an optional side bet of $1 in order to activate the progressive jackpot feature.

The progressive jackpot goes to the player who gets four suited aces although players who get fewer aces and non-suited aces will also win a portion of the jackpot. The size of blackjack jackpots, payouts offered, and even the rules tend to vary among casinos and software providers.
